👶🩺 Hands-On Learning for Oran Students!

Oran’s Child Development class recently had the opportunity to visit the OB floor at Saint Francis Hospital for an exciting, hands-on learning experience. Students toured the unit and even watched a human simulator demonstrate the process of giving birth, helping them better understand pregnancy, childbirth, and potential future careers in healthcare. Thank you to the Saint Francis OB team for giving our students such an eye-opening and educational experience! 💙

🎉 Big News from Oran FCCLA! 🎉

On March 15–17, Oran FCCLA had five groups compete in STAR Events at the State Leadership Conference. Our students represented Oran incredibly well, earning 🥇 three 1st place finishes and 🥈 one 2nd place finish!

Because of their hard work, four groups have qualified to attend Nationals in Washington, D.C. this summer!

These students put in countless hours preparing their projects and presentations, and we are so proud of the dedication and effort they showed.

Our Oran Family and Consumer Sciences (FACS) classes recently partnered with Kids Feeding Kids to make a difference in our community! On March 12, our students proudly packaged and served 250 servings of chicken fried rice to help feed families in our community!

Throughout the week, students dedicated their time and effort to prepping ingredients and cooking. In total, they prepared 150 pounds of rice, 25 pounds of chicken, 300 eggs, and 18 pounds of vegetables to create these meals.

We are so proud of our students for their hard work, teamwork, and commitment to serving others. Projects like this not only build valuable cooking skills but also show the power of giving back to our community. 💛🍚
